Gameplay Rules and Tumble Mechanics

The foundational rules of the game rely on a clustering system rather than sequential lines across reels. To secure a payout, at least five identical symbols must connect horizontally or vertically anywhere on the 49-cell board.

Every successful combination triggers the Tumble feature. The winning symbols explode and disappear from the grid, allowing the remaining symbols to drop to the bottom of the screen. Empty positions are then filled with new symbols falling from above. This tumbling sequence continues indefinitely until no new winning combinations appear, compiling all accumulated payouts before adding them to the balance.

Multiplier Spots Feature

The most significant structural element in the game is the positional multiplier system. This feature turns standard grid cells into highly valuable targets during extended tumbles.

  • Marking the Spot: When a winning symbol explodes, it highlights its exact position on the grid.

  • Multiplier Activation: If another symbol explodes on that identical marked spot during the same tumble sequence, a x2 multiplier is attached to that cell.

  • Doubling Values: Every subsequent explosion on a multiplier spot doubles its value. The progression scales rapidly from x2 up to a maximum cap of x1024.

  • Additive Combinations: If a winning cluster covers multiple multiplier spots, their values are added together before applying to the payout.

In the base game, all marked spots and their corresponding multipliers are cleared completely when a tumbling sequence ends.

Free Spins and Super Bonus Round

The Rocket Gumball Machine acts as the Scatter symbol, appearing on all reels. Landing between 3 and 7 Scatters anywhere on the screen triggers the bonus round, awarding 10, 12, 15, 20, or 30 free spins respectively.

The critical distinction in this mode is that marked spots and their multipliers remain locked in place for the entire duration of the round. They do not reset between spins, allowing values to compound heavily across the entire set of spins. Players can also retrigger additional spins by landing more Scatters during the feature.

Players have direct access to the bonus features via the UI. The standard "Buy Free Spins" option costs 100x the total bet and triggers a random number of Scatters with a 96.52% RTP. The premium "Buy Super Free Spins" option costs 500x the total bet with a 96.44% RTP. In the Super version, the feature starts with an inherent advantage: x2 multipliers are already added to all 49 spots on the grid before the first spin even begins.

Structural Probability & Grid Dynamics

Unlike traditional payline slots, the mathematical architecture of this game relies on a cluster-pays geometry across a 7x7 grid, creating 49 independent positions. Analyzing the structural probability explains the high volatility rating and the pacing of the gameplay.

To trigger the lowest possible payout, a minimum of 5 identical symbols must connect adjacently. Mathematically, this requires a single symbol type to cover at least 10.2% of the active board in a localized group. Achieving the highest tier of symbol payouts (15+ symbols) requires a 30.6% grid coverage. Because the game engine uses 7 different standard paying symbols competing for space, the probability of a single symbol naturally occupying nearly a third of the board adjacently on a base spin is relatively low, leading to the highly volatile pacing of the math model.

The true mathematical advantage emerges during the tumble sequence and its interaction with the Multiplier Spots. When a minimum winning cluster of 5 symbols is removed, 10.2% of the grid is cleared. The remaining 44 symbols compress downwards. At this moment, the density of the remaining symbols temporarily increases, artificially improving the odds that the 5 new cascading symbols will complete secondary clusters.

More importantly, this cascading probability shift fuels the geometric scaling of the multipliers. Reaching the x1024 cap on a single cell demands an exponential progression, meaning that exact coordinate must be part of 11 consecutive cluster explosions during a single spin sequence. This structural depth explains why the base game relies heavily on long chain reactions. Sugar Rush vs Sugar Rush 1000: Core Differences

While both titles share the exact same visual design, 7x7 grid layout, and base symbol payouts, the 1000 edition represents a massive mathematical overhaul built for extreme variance. The core tumbling mechanics remain identical, but the underlying engine of the upgraded version is designed to support much longer chain reactions and significantly higher limits.

The most critical upgrade lies within the multiplier spots mechanic. The original Sugar Rush release caps individual grid multipliers at x128. In contrast, the newer version allows these grid positions to continue doubling up to a massive x1024. This extended mathematical ceiling directly fuels the increased maximum win limit, which jumps from 5,000x in the classic version to 25,000x the base bet in the upgrade.

The other major structural addition is the secondary bonus buy tier. The original game limits players to a standard bonus purchase for 100x the wager. The upgraded title introduces the "Buy Super Free Spins" feature for 500x the wager, which drastically alters the starting state of the bonus by pre-populating the entire 49-cell board with x2 multipliers.
